OpenStack Telemetry (Ceilometer) Alarming
Go to file
Lingxian Kong a8285b564d Support Heat auto-healing notifier
The auto-healing notifier works together with loadbalancer_member_health
evaluator.

Presumably, the end user defines a Heat template which contains an
autoscaling group and all the members in the group are joined in an
Octavia load balancer in order to expose service to the outside, so that
when the stack scales up or scales down, Heat makes sure the new members
are joining the load balancer automatically and the old members are
removed.

However, this notifier deals with the situation that when some member
fails, the stack could be recovered by marking the given autoscaling
group member unhealthy, then update Heat stack in place.

Change-Id: I6e92d1fc2125e155bb5068ff2c14fa318b126442
2019-05-16 11:26:13 +12:00
aodh Support Heat auto-healing notifier 2019-05-16 11:26:13 +12:00
devstack Replace git.openstack.org URLs with opendev.org URLs 2019-04-22 14:20:45 +08:00
doc Replace git.openstack.org URLs with opendev.org URLs 2019-04-22 14:20:45 +08:00
playbooks/legacy OpenDev Migration Patch 2019-04-19 19:30:26 +00:00
rally-jobs Update and optimize documentation links 2017-07-18 16:03:22 +08:00
releasenotes Support Heat auto-healing notifier 2019-05-16 11:26:13 +12:00
tools fix gate 2017-09-11 17:21:06 +00:00
.coveragerc Clean config in source code 2016-02-05 08:45:38 +00:00
.gitignore Implement policy in code - reno and doc (end) 2017-11-08 11:18:26 +07:00
.gitreview OpenDev Migration Patch 2019-04-19 19:30:26 +00:00
.mailmap add mailmap to avoid dup of authors 2014-10-09 10:31:23 +03:00
.testr.conf Correct concurrency of gabbi tests for gabbi 1.22.0 2016-06-16 12:45:33 +01:00
.zuul.yaml OpenDev Migration Patch 2019-04-19 19:30:26 +00:00
babel.cfg Ground work for transifex-ify ceilometer. 2012-12-18 10:14:03 +08:00
bindep.txt Add python 3.7 gating 2018-07-26 11:43:28 +02:00
CONTRIBUTING.rst Update and optimize documentation links 2017-07-18 16:03:22 +08:00
HACKING.rst Update and optimize documentation links 2017-07-18 16:03:22 +08:00
LICENSE include a copy of the ASL 2.0 2013-03-15 14:25:48 +00:00
MAINTAINERS Remove MIA maintainer 2018-04-12 10:59:40 +02:00
README.rst update README.rst 2017-12-04 16:01:13 +08:00
requirements.txt Support Heat auto-healing notifier 2019-05-16 11:26:13 +12:00
run-functional-tests.sh tests: rework functional live tests 2017-07-13 12:57:41 +02:00
run-tests.sh fix gate 2017-09-11 17:21:06 +00:00
setup.cfg Support Heat auto-healing notifier 2019-05-16 11:26:13 +12:00
setup.py Update the requirements 2015-07-07 11:42:13 +08:00
tox.ini Add install_command in tox.ini 2019-04-22 14:27:52 +08:00

aodh

Release notes can be read online at:

https://docs.openstack.org/aodh/latest/contributor/releasenotes/index.html

Documentation for the project can be found at:

https://docs.openstack.org/aodh/latest/

The project home is at:

https://launchpad.net/aodh

Bugs and feature requests are tracked on Launchpad at:

https://bugs.launchpad.net/aodh